Definition

Presumptive refers to something that is based on reasonable assumption or inference, often implying a likelihood or expectation of a certain status or outcome.

Sample Sentences

  1. The presumptive heir to the throne was celebrated across the kingdom.
  2. In a presumptive manner, she assumed everyone would agree with her decision.
  3. His presumptive guilt made it difficult for him to find professional opportunities.
  4. The court ruled that the presumptive evidence was sufficient to proceed with the trial.
  5. She made a presumptive statement about his intentions without knowing the full story.
